General description
1-Bromo-4-methylpentane can be synthesized by treating 4-methyl-1-pentanol with phosphorous tribromide. The conformational analysis of its liquid-state and solid-state IR and Raman spectra and showed the presence of a mixture of PC,PH, and P′H conformers.
Application
1-Bromo-4-methylpentane may be used in the synthesis of:
- diethyl 2-(4′-methylpentyl)malonate
- 1,3-bis(4-(isopentyloxy)phenyl)urea
- 1,3-bis(4-(isopentyloxy)phenyl)thiourea
- 13-methyl-1-[(tetrahydropyran-2-yl)oxy]tetradec-8-yne
- 15-methyl-1-[(tetrahydropyran-2-yl)oxy]hexadec-10-yne
- 3-[2-isohexyloxy-3-(hydroxymethyl]-5-phenyl-2-isohexyloxybenzyl alcohol
